Leeds fell victim to Homewood and their airtight defense on Friday. They lost 3-0 to the Patriots. While losing is never fun, Leeds can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Alabama soccer rankings (they are ranked 66th, while Homewood are ranked fifth).
Leeds has also traveled a rocky road recently, having lost three of their last four games. That's put a noticeable dent in their 4-8-1 record this season. Homewood's victory was their fifth straight at home, which pushed their record up to 15-2.
Leeds and Homewood will both get a bit of extra prep time before their next matchups. The next time Leeds sees the pitch they'll take on Jasper at 7:30 p.m. on April 1. As for Homewood, their break will end when they face Jackson-Olin at 6:30 p.m. on April 1.
